为什么服务器ecc内存无法全部识别

worktile 其他 100

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器 ECC 内存无法全部识别的原因有多个可能性。下面我将会详细介绍几个主要原因:

    1. 硬件兼容性问题:服务器主板和 ECC 内存之间的兼容性可能存在问题。不同的服务器厂商和型号支持的 ECC 内存规格和类型可能不同。在这种情况下,服务器可能只能识别部分 ECC 内存,而不能全部识别。

    解决方法:首先,确保使用的 ECC 内存符合服务器主板的规格要求。可以参考服务器主板的技术规格手册,查看支持的 ECC 内存类型和最大容量。如果使用的 ECC 内存与主板兼容,但仍然无法全部识别,可以尝试升级服务器 BIOS 或者固件,以获得更好的兼容性。此外,还可以联系服务器厂商获取技术支持,寻求解决方案。

    1. 内存插槽问题:服务器通常有多个内存插槽,在插槽中安装 ECC 内存时,可能导致一些插槽无法识别内存模块。

    解决方法:首先,确保将内存模块安装在正确的插槽中。服务器主板上通常有标记或者颜色编码,可以指导正确安装内存。如果仍然无法识别,可以尝试重新安装内存模块,确保插槽是否存在故障。此外,还可以尝试重新组织内存模块的安装顺序,以充分利用服务器的所有插槽。

    1. 内存故障或损坏:ECC 内存可能存在故障或者损坏,导致服务器无法正确识别。

    解决方法:可以尝试将 ECC 内存模块逐个插入不同的插槽,并重新启动服务器,以确定是否存在故障或者损坏的内存模块。如果发现具体的内存模块有问题,可以尝试更换新的内存模块。

    总体来说,服务器 ECC 内存无法全部识别的原因可能是硬件兼容性问题、内存插槽问题或者内存故障。通过仔细检查硬件兼容性、重新安装内存模块并排查故障,可以解决这个问题。如果遇到无法解决的情况,建议联系服务器厂商获取专业的技术支持。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器在使用ECC内存时,可能会遇到内存无法全部识别的问题。以下是导致这种问题出现的可能原因:

    1. 计算机主板的限制:服务器主板可能有一些限制,无法支持大容量的内存模块。这可能是因为主板设计时,没有考虑到未来会出现更高容量的内存模块,或者是主板硬件限制导致无法识别全部内存。

    2. 物理插槽连接问题:有时候,服务器内存插槽可能存在连接问题,导致插槽无法正确识别内存模块。这可能是由于接触不良、锈蚀、灰尘等因素造成的。

    3. 内存模块兼容性问题:不同的服务器厂商有自己的内存兼容性列表,只有列在该列表上的特定型号的内存才能被服务器完全识别。如果服务器使用的是不在列表上的内存模块,部分内存可能无法被识别。

    4. 内存插槽故障:服务器的内存插槽可能出现故障,导致无法正确识别内存模块。这可能是由于插槽接触不良、电气故障等原因引起的。

    5. BIOS设置错误:服务器的BIOS设置可能错误配置,导致无法完全识别内存。这可能是由于BIOS版本过旧、配置错误等原因造成的。

    解决服务器ECC内存无法全部识别的问题,可以尝试以下方法:

    1. 更新服务器BIOS:检查服务器厂商的官方网站,下载最新的BIOS版本,更新服务器的BIOS。新的BIOS版本可能修复了一些内存识别问题。

    2. 检查内存插槽连接:确保服务器内存插槽连接良好,没有松动或者脏污等问题。可以尝试重新插拔内存模块,清除插槽上的灰尘,确保插槽和内存接触良好。

    3. 检查内存兼容性:确保服务器使用的内存模块在厂商的兼容性列表上。如果使用的内存模块不在列表上,尝试更换为兼容的内存模块。

    4. 确认主板限制:查看服务器主板的技术规格,确认是否存在限制,无法支持大容量的内存模块。如果是主板限制,只能更换支持更高内存容量的主板。

    5. 联系技术支持:如果以上方法仍然无法解决问题,可以联系服务器厂商的技术支持部门。他们可能能够提供更具体的解决方案,或者更换故障的硬件组件。

    1年前 0条评论
  • 飞飞的头像
    飞飞
    Worktile&PingCode市场小伙伴
    评论

    标题:服务器 ECC 内存无法全部识别的原因及解决方法

    1. 了解 ECC 内存

    首先,我们需要了解 ECC 内存。ECC(Error Correction Code)内存是一种能够自动检测和纠正内存中出现的错误的内存技术。它使用一种特殊的算法来检查和纠正内存中的位错误,确保服务器数据的完整性和可靠性。

    2. 服务器 ECC 内存无法全部识别的可能原因

    2.1. 不支持的内存频率

    服务器主板和处理器通常只支持特定频率的内存模块。如果您安装了不支持的内存模块频率,服务器可能只能识别部分内存。

    解决方法:

    • 查阅服务器技术规格书或咨询供应商,确定服务器支持的内存频率。
    • 更换成支持的内存模块频率。

    2.2. 内存槽或内存插槽故障

    如果服务器的内存槽或内存插槽出现故障,可能导致服务器无法完全识别内存。

    解决方法:

    • 检查内存槽或内存插槽是否有任何物理损坏。
    • 清洁内存槽或内存插槽,确保金属接点没有灰尘或腐蚀。

    2.3. 内存模块不兼容

    某些服务器可能对内存模块的兼容性要求较高,如果安装了不兼容的内存模块,服务器可能无法完全识别内存。

    解决方法:

    • 查阅服务器技术规格书,查找支持的内存模块型号。
    • 更换成兼容的内存模块。

    2.4. BIOS 设置有误

    如果服务器的 BIOS 设置不正确,可能会导致服务器无法正确识别内存。

    解决方法:

    • 进入服务器 BIOS 设置界面。
    • 确保启用了 ECC 内存功能。
    • 确保内存设置与安装的内存模块匹配。

    2.5. 内存模块安装错误

    如果内存模块没有正确安装到内存插槽中,或者没有按照双通道技术正确安装,可能导致服务器无法全部识别内存。

    解决方法:

    • 仔细阅读服务器和内存模块的安装指南。
    • 确保内存模块完全插入到内存槽中,并锁定在位。
    • 确保使用双通道技术正确安装内存模块(配对插槽)。

    2.6. 内存模块损坏

    如果内存模块本身出现损坏,可能会导致服务器无法正确识别内存。

    解决方法:

    • 使用诊断工具测试内存模块,查找是否有损坏的模块。
    • 如果发现有损坏的模块,更换它们。

    3. 结论

    服务器 ECC 内存无法完全识别的原因可能是多种多样的。通过仔细检查内存模块的兼容性、服务器的技术规格和BIOS设置,以及正确安装和测试,可以解决大部分问题。如果问题仍然存在,建议寻求供应商或技术支持的帮助,以获得进一步的诊断和解决方案。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部